Top 5 Jigsaw Puzzle Apps Performance in Georgia Q3 2023
Explore the performance of the top 5 jigsaw puzzle apps on a unified platform in Georgia during Q3 2023, including tr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
During the third quarter of 2023, the top 5 jigsaw puzzle apps in Georgia on a unified platform showcased varied performance trends in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a detailed look at each app’s metrics.
Puzzle ∙ from Solitaire Games Studio saw a gradual decline in weekly revenue from $13 at the end of June to $6 by the end of September. Weekly downloads peaked at 9K in late July but decreased to 2K by the end of September.
Puzzle Villa: Jigsaw Games from ZiMAD experienced a notable spike in weekly revenue, reaching $29 by the week of July 24, before dropping to $0 for the remainder of the quarter. Weekly downloads fluctuated, peaking at 55K in mid-July and then dipping to 12K by the end of September.
Kid-E-Cats Sea Adventure Games from DevGame OU recorded varied revenue, starting at $9 in early August and ending at $4 by late September. Downloads saw significant peaks and troughs, with a high of 19K in the last week of September.
Jigsaw Puzzles Now from Zephyrmobile maintained a consistent weekly revenue of $3, with slight increases to $4 in late September. Downloads were stable initially, peaking at 7K in July but declined to 2K by the end of the quarter.
Jigsaw Puzzles Epic from Kristanix AS showed a steady weekly revenue averaging around $3, with minor fluctuations. Downloads remained fairly consistent around 7K per week, with a slight drop to 2K in the last week of September.
